When we talk about air "holding" water we are really talking about the amount of water that would be in the vapor phase relative to the amount that would be liquid at equilibrium.
WebThe air doesn’t really ’hold’ the water, that’s just a loose expression. If you took all the air away, there would still be water vapor (gas) above the liquid water. The density of that vapor depends a lot on the water temperature, when the vapor and liquid have reached equilibrium, with equal numbers of water molecules going from each ... WebSo, cooling the air (decreasing its temperature) is one way to achieve net condensation. If the air cools enough (temperature decreases enough) that the evaporation rate becomes less than the condensation rate, net condensation can occur, and …
